BETTER HOUSING
ACTIVITY IN ENGLAND NEW RECORD ANTICIPATED (British Official Wireless) .RUGBY, (ith April. Tn the past 15 years no fewer than 2.175,000 new houses have been creeled in England, and of Ibis minilier nearly 1,900,(100 in the last (en years. 00 per cent, of them by private enterprise. Though the population of Britain has increased by only 2,000,000 since the war. the new housing accommodation provided is sufficient for three times that number. The greatest activity has taken place in the suburbs of lamdon, where nearly 500,000 new homes have been built in a decade. This devlopmcnt is reflected in official returns of building societies, which show that since 1022 the amount advanced on mortgages has substantially increased each year in Hie last seven years. The annual total has nearly doubled, and it is predicted Hint the 1033 figures will reach £100.000.000 nearlv £10.000,000 above the record total of 1931.
